gc8 970 Posted February 20, 2017 Did some testing and found at that the fullCrew with cargo filter doesnt work for the V44-X because the passenger seats are considered "turrets" (atleast some of them, my guess is the ones near the ramp). this is how I tested: _clist = fullCrew _helo; diag_log format["%1",_clist]; V44-X: prints: [[vxD,""driver"",-1,[],false], [testguy3,""cargo"",2,[],false], [B Alpha 1-2:2,""Turret"",-1,[0],false], [B Alpha 1-2:3,""Turret"",-1,[1],false], [B Alpha 1-2:4,""Turret"",-1,[2],false], [testguy1,""Turret"",0,[3],true], [testguy2,""Turret"",1,[4],true]]" CH67 (huron): prints: [hrD,""driver"",-1,[],false], [testguy1,""cargo"",0,[],false], [testguy2,""cargo"",1,[],false], [testguy3,""cargo"",2,[],false], [B Alpha 1-3:2,""Turret"",-1,[0],false]]" (testguys are all supposed to be in cargo) Edit: However the boolean value tells if the turret is a "personTurret"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
